	Hmm. Well yes, but I would like to interject a proviso to that.
	Its important to note that deathstrike(), the fctn handling the 
	attack for the death rune, uses the *overall* level of the 
	defender to determine success. So, under the skills system,
	the owner of the rune *casts* it at their magician level, which
	will *always* be equal to or less than their players *overall*
	level. Therefore, I wouldnt think it very likely that a player
	could kill themselves by casting rune of death (at least until
	things are changed...)
